machiinate, I feel MGMT has created a good album with a consistent and interesting sound. The songs on this new album seem more experimental and subtle than most on Oracular Spectacular.

While I prefer their hits ("Time to Pretend," "Kids," etc.), I don't dislike their other songs, and some I quite like or at least find interesting on their new album. I didn't know they were booed in London. That's pretty harsh!
